🎮 【Pandoras Box 78S】The latest upgraded Pandora Arcade system is smoother in operation and more powerful in function. The newly added in-game cheating function and one-click (Start+A) fighting combo give you a different gaming experience.The H3 chip and 128GB memory card make it powerful enough to balance smooth game operation and a large number of personalized customization settings.
🎮 【12 Grid Classification】32000 arcade games is arranged on the homepage according to different categories. You can view the games you have played recently and quickly search for the games you want by name. 161 3D, 1037 cheat versions and 594 modified versions of games allow you to play without restrictions. Numerous 3-4 player games are available for family and friends to enjoy together (requires 2 additional USB controllers).
🎮 【Impeccable Details】Get a flawless console pattern by removing the clear protective film from your console’s surface, and enjoy greater gaming immersion with our 360-degree universal joystick and multi-color backlighting.You can tune in to the game by turning up the TV sound and turning off the volume on the built-in speakers. You can also use the headphone jack if you don’t want to disturb others.
🎮 【More DIY features】Take control of your gaming experience through features like Pause/Save/Load/Search/Delete Games, Recently list, Favorite list, and even customize buttons, controllers, language settings(English Spanish Korean Chinese), and difficulty levels using the key behind the console.
🎮【Split Controllers】 This split arcade game machine is very light, allowing you to play on the sofa or recliner. You no longer have to worry about sitting crowded with friends or interfering with each other when playing fierce fighting games.When connecting to a TV, please make sure to switch to the signal source corresponding to the cable.
🎮 【Note】The pattern on the machine’s surface has a transparent protective film that can be peeled off.For common system malfunctions, you can reset the machine by removing and inserting the memory card. We also offer a replacement card service.

Lots of value to item, but a tad flimsy and lacking true instructions.
I’ll start off with how much I love this item in general. It’s got 8000 games – what’s not to love? Most run well, definitely not all (and I have had hardly any time to try more than a dozen or so yet). I would talk all about the positives, but the other reviews cover those. It runs thousands of games – what’s not great about that? But I’ll cover the not-so-great stuff more in depth. First off, the board itself is actually smaller/lighter than my older one. It no longer is built of metal – this feels like acrylic and plastic. The cover came with scratches in it – I’m unsure if it is just a plastic protective wrap on it that I’m supposed to tear off or not – I’m always afraid to just rip it off because it could ruin the whole top if it isn’t meant to come off – but yes, scratches on arrival on it. Second, the controls feel cheaper than earlier designs too. Buttons just feel a bit less “springy”, less arcade-like. The feet on the bottom don’t work on all surfaces either – if the tabletop is plastic and smooth, this thing will slide right across it. The feet have zero traction on that type of tabletop. So when two people play on it (or even just one) it has a tendency to slide around. And now to the software issues – so I specifically got this version for the wifi. To my surprise, it has a wired connection on it too, which was a bonus. But wifi works fine, if not really, really slow. To be honest, wired connection isn’t much faster when downloading. And downloading is the major problem on here. So the store will load….most of the time. But randomly after downloading 0-3 games, it will hang, say there is no response from the server, and then will absolutely not work again until you shut off the whole unit, turn it back on and go back to the marketplace. EVERY 0-3 games. Do you know how long this takes to get anything downloaded? Some games won’t install correctly, so you have to do it again. And then there’s another issue – there’s no way that I can see how to tell how much space is left on the SD card. How many extra games can you download? Who knows. I deleted a bunch to make room, but I’m absolutely clueless on when I run out of space. I had a thought that the server issue might actually be the SD card being full, but I honestly have no idea. It stopped doing the server issue as often when I deleted games, but the more I add, the more frequently it happens. So I’m clueless. The system randomly shut off while I was deleting games once too. And finally….a lot of these “3D” games on the system are mostly just PSP and Dreamcast games. It comes with a bunch preloaded….but here’s the thing. They aren’t arcade-style games. Some are even visual novels. The only way to properly play these is by connecting a controller via usb, because they are absolutely not set up to be played with an arcade stick – some require a second stick that only comes on controllers like Xbox or PS ones, so unless you’ve got one lying around, these games are unplayable. Oh, and back to some games being like visual novels – yeah, those types are ALL the Chinese or Japanese version of the game, so unless you can read in that language, they aren’t playable. Oh, and some of those PSP game that are fighting games – those can’t be 2 players, because technically you’d need someone with another PSP to connect to to fight, and this is emulated, so no can do. Also, the categories are all messed up – groupings don’t even show all games, some are categorized incorrectly, and so it will take you years to cycle through all the games.It sounds like I hate this item, lol, and I don’t. But these are all notes that no one else really wrote about, and they are beyond frustrating, so I wish I had a little better idea of what I was getting into beforehand so I could set my expectations appropriately. The chip on this (S18) is really zippy and runs most games well, especially these 3D ones. You can tell they’ve improved the hardware and software from earlier versions. I just think there’s a lot of bugs to be worked out that are never addressed and never will be fixed, which is unfortunate. Also, adding games is a nightmare manually, so I’m all for just hoping the store works right. But come on, could they at least give us a way to see how full the SD card is? -_-
